Preheat oven to 350F. In small bowl, combine all ingredients except pork; set aside. In 13 x 9-inch baking or roasting pan, arrange pork. With knife, score (lightly cut) top of pork. Spoon soup mixture evenly over pork. Bake uncovered 1 hour or until meat thermometer reaches 160F. Makes about 8 servings. Also terrific with Lipton Recipe Secrets Golden Herb with Lemon, Savory Herb with Garlic, Fiesta Herb with Red Pepper or Onion-Mushroom Soup Mix. *If using Lipton Recipe Secrets Savory Herb with Garlic Soup Mix, omit garlic.
